> 2. Section 1.2 said: " There are DHCP options that a
> network operator can use to configure devices such as a VoIP phone.
> DHCP options 66, 150 (TFTP/HTTP server names), option 120 (SIP Server),
> or even option 157 (Certificate Provisioning) " Can you add reference
> to new introduced DHCP options?
